I have just gotten this working to display a sidebox in a middlebox group. I had the outline working, but ran into the fact that anything called from a function loses page variables unless they are explicitly declared "global"... which obviously is not acceptable for universal use. I had to rework the function into a module file (a bit more cumbersome to insert the call into the tpl_index_ files), but once I did that it worked like a charm.
I also bypassed the question of renaming FILENAME_DEFINE_ constants by putting the filename call into admin. Now you can set each middlebox location and whether you want a particular sidebox to appear in its place.

V3.0 has been submitted to Plugins. I have added two new middlebox locations, to appear on all pages either above or below individual page content. This will facilitate use of stock sideboxes on single-column websites.
